Research Associate (2-Year Term) - AI in Manufacturing
About the role
Job Description
The University of Toronto is seeking a Research Associate to work on AI in Manufacturing. The successful candidate will be responsible for:
- Conducting research in AI applications in manufacturing.
- Collaborating with industry partners and academic researchers.
- Publishing research findings in peer-reviewed journals.
- Presenting research at conferences and workshops.
Required Qualifications
- PhD in Computer Science, Engineering, or a related field.
- Strong programming skills in Python and C++.
- Experience with machine learning frameworks such as TensorFlow or PyTorch.
- Excellent communication and teamwork skills.
Preferred Qualifications
- Experience in manufacturing processes and systems.
- Knowledge of data analysis and visualization tools.
- Previous experience in a research environment.
Additional Information
This position is a 2-year term appointment with the possibility of extension based on funding and performance.
